报错无法载入程辑包‘ggplot2’
时间: 2023-05-24 10:06:30 浏览: 1740
这可能是由于 ggplot2 包没有正确安装或加载导致的。可以尝试重新安装 ggplot2 包并加载它,以解决此错误。步骤如下:
1. 确保已经安装 R 包管理器(如 CRAN、Bioconductor 或 GitHub)。如果尚未安装,请按照指示安装。例如,在 CRAN 上,可以使用以下命令进行安装: install.packages("ggplot2")
2. 加载 ggplot2 包。可以使用以下命令加载 ggplot2 包:library(ggplot2)
如果这些步骤不起作用,可能需要检查您的 R 环境和路径,以查看是否有任何问题。如果仍然无法解决问题,请考虑咨询 R 社区的专家或寻求其他相关资源和支持。
相关问题
Error: 无法载入程辑包‘ggplot2’
### 回答1:
这个错误通常表示你的R环境中没有安装ggplot2包。你可以使用以下代码安装它:
```
install.packages("ggplot2")
```
如果你已经安装了ggplot2,但仍然出现这个错误,请确保你已经正确加载了包。你可以使用以下代码加载它:
```
library(ggplot2)
```
如果问题仍然存在,建议你检查你的R环境和包管理。
### 回答2:
这个错误提示表明在使用R语言的过程中,无法成功载入名为‘ggplot2’的程辑包。原因可能有以下几种:
1. 未安装‘ggplot2’包:在使用R语言中的程辑包之前,需要先安装该程辑包。可以通过以下代码进行安装:
``` R
install.packages("ggplot2")
```
如果之前没有安装过该包,需要联网下载并安装。
2. 未加载‘ggplot2’包:即使安装了‘ggplot2’包,也需要使用以下代码将其加载到当前的R环境中:
``` R
library(ggplot2)
```
这样才能在后续的代码中正常使用该包提供的功能。
3. 程辑包名称拼写错误:在R语言中,程辑包名称需要严格按照大小写和拼写规则。请确认代码中对‘ggplot2’的拼写是否正确,注意区分大小写。
4. 程辑包所在路径错误:有时候,R语言无法找到程辑包的正确路径,导致载入失败。可以尝试使用以下代码手动指定程辑包路径:
``` R
library(ggplot2, lib.loc = "your_package_path")
```
将"your_package_path"替换为实际安装‘ggplot2’包的路径。
如果以上的方法仍然无法解决问题,可能需要检查R语言的版本、依赖关系以及操作系统等方面的因素,或者参考相关的文档和社区帖子以获得更具体的帮助。
### 回答3:
Error: 无法载入程辑包‘ggplot2’。这个错误通常表示在运行R代码时,找不到并加载所需的ggplot2包。ggplot2是一个用于数据可视化的R包,它提供了一种灵活和强大的绘图语法。
要解决这个问题,首先需要检查是否已经安装了ggplot2包。可以在R命令行中尝试运行以下代码:`install.packages("ggplot2")`。如果已经安装了包,可能需要更新到最新版本,可以使用`update.packages()`命令来进行更新。
如果安装包失败或者下载速度很慢,可以尝试更改CRAN镜像源。可以使用`options(repos = "https://cran.rstudio.com/")`来设置使用RStudio的官方CRAN镜像源,或者使用其他可靠和快速的CRAN镜像源。
另外,可以检查ggplot2包是否加载正确。可以尝试运行`library(ggplot2)`命令来加载包。如果仍然报错,可能是由于包路径错误导致的。可以尝试使用`install.packages("ggplot2", lib = "路径")`来重新安装ggplot2包,其中路径是指定包位置的绝对路径。
如果以上方法都无法解决问题,可能需要检查R的版本和所使用的操作系统是否兼容。确保你的R版本符合ggplot2包的要求,并且操作系统也得到良好支持。
总结起来,要解决无法载入ggplot2包的错误,可以尝试安装、更新包以及更改镜像源。同时,也需要确保R版本和操作系统的兼容性。如果问题仍然存在,可以搜索相关的错误信息或者求助于R社区来获取更多帮助。
Warning: 程辑包‘survminer’是用R版本4.2.3 来建造的载入需要的程辑包:ggplot2 Warning: 程辑包‘ggplot2’是用R版本4.2.3 来建造的Error: package or namespace load failed for ‘ggplot2’ in loadNamespace(i, c(lib.loc, .libPaths()), versionCheck = vI[[i]]): 载入了名字空间‘rlang’ 1.0.6,但需要的是>= 1.1.0 Error: 无法载入程辑包‘ggplot2’
,原因是程序加载时出现了版本不匹配的问题。需要先升级rlang包的版本到1.1.0以上,然后再重新加载ggplot2包即可。可以尝试运行以下代码进行升级:
install.packages("rlang")
library(rlang)
如果升级后仍然无法加载ggplot2包,可以尝试重新安装ggplot2包或者检查是否存在其他包的冲突。
阅读全文